Biological Background: HDAC4 Function and Localization
- HDAC4 is a class IIa histone deacetylase that represses transcription by removing acetyl groups from N-terminal lysines of core histones (H2A, H2B, H3, H4), promoting chromatin condensation.
- Through its N-terminal extension, HDAC4 interacts with MEF2 transcription factors (MEF2A, MEF2C, MEF2D), regulating muscle differentiation and hypertrophy.
- In breast cancer, HDAC4 participates in MTA1-mediated epigenetic silencing of ESR1, contributing to hormonal therapy resistance.
- HDAC4 deacetylates HSPA1A and HSPA1B at lysine 77, enhancing their interaction with co-chaperone STUB1 and influencing protein quality control. Related references: PMID:27708256
- HDAC4 shuttles between the nucleus and cytoplasm; phosphorylation by kinases such as CaMK promotes 14-3-3 binding and cytoplasmic retention, while sumoylation and ubiquitination regulate its stability and localization.
- The enzyme is zinc-dependent, with a conserved catalytic domain that coordinates Zn²⁺; mutations disrupting metal binding impair activity.
- Alternative splicing of HDAC4 generates isoforms with distinct tissue-specific expression and regulatory functions.
Experimental Guidance and Technical Tips
- The immunogen spans residues 451–650, located within the conserved deacetylase domain; this region is >95% identical across human, mouse, and rat, explaining the broad cross-reactivity.
- For Western blot (WB), a band at ~119 kDa is expected; use nuclear-enriched lysates (e.g., HeLa, C2C12) and validate with appropriate positive and negative controls.
- In immunohistochemistry (IHC-P), antigen retrieval conditions (e.g., citrate buffer pH 6.0) and primary antibody dilution must be optimized; both nuclear and cytoplasmic staining patterns are possible depending on tissue and disease state.
- For ELISA, the antibody may be used as a capture or detection reagent; pairing with a validated HDAC4 detection antibody is recommended for sandwich assays.
- The polyclonal nature offers robust signal amplification, but lot-to-lot consistency should be verified for quantitative applications.
